Supervisors manage teams, ensuring production meets standards while overseeing safety, rosters, training, and completing admin tasks.

Supervisors need administration and leadership skills. Try the Certificate IV or Diploma of Leadership and Management. These courses can be completed in under a year. VET qualifications, experience, and technical skills in your employment sector will also help.
